Greetings... moved into place built in 1987.
Patio doors were in horrible shape, but I was able to locate bottom roller assemblies. Three patio doors now open very nicely BUT rubbing at top really obvious now.
Out of the three doors, I only have one [out of 6 original horizontal top rollers], which appears to be very similar to Peachtree, except for top wheel diameter. Note that I only have one actual assembly, I found pieces of the other five when disassembling the doors for bottom wheel replacement... lots of UV damage in South Florida.
The top slot/track inside width is 1 13/64ths inch - because of wear, lets say a bit less, 1 3/16". Existing horizontal wheel shows wear, but by extrapolation, wheel was originally about 1 5/32"
Bottom line, SKU 84-082 wheel is too big. Is there anything else available?
